Reaching the 50th print edition of Discover Brighton feels like a moment to pause and say a heartfelt thank you to the city that made it all possible.

When we first launched Discover Brighton, our vision was simple. We wanted to create a community magazine that celebrated everything that makes our city special. We believed there was an appetite for a publication that shone a light on the people and places that make Brighton and Hove thrive. Fifty editions later, that belief has only grown stronger.

Discover Brighton has always been about more than listings or recommendations. It’s about storytelling. Every issue is an opportunity to showcase the talent, resilience and innovation that exists right here on our doorstep.

Over the past 50 editions, Discover Brighton has grown alongside the city itself. We’ve had the privilege of witnessing new businesses open their doors, creatives find their audiences, and community initiatives flourish. In many ways, the magazine has become a small but meaningful thread in the fabric of Brighton and Hove – connecting people, celebrating local success stories and supporting the independent businesses that make our city so special.

Of course, none of this would be possible without the incredible team behind the magazine. I feel enormously proud to work alongside such a passionate, creative and hard-working group of people. Their dedication, ideas and commitment to celebrating Brighton make Discover Brighton what it is today.

Here’s to the next 50 editions and to continuing to celebrate the incredible community we’re lucky enough to call home.
